Output 2428633ab2b52c7ab103cb6ee07a84db7427b7c69276c85e62789eaa5a689a29:2

value
2800000000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 592cdf2790196ebeb3a7f4a14a5b9b85afccb521 OP_EQUALVERIFY OP_CHECKSIG
address
DDGcS56vNKg2HKb1Vq1QmSjpr82vk1EuTa
transaction
2428633ab2b52c7ab103cb6ee07a84db7427b7c69276c85e62789eaa5a689a29